About Wispr
Wispr Flow is making it as effortless to interact with your devices as talking to a close friend. Voice is the most natural, powerful way to communicate — and we're building the interfaces to make that a reality.

Today, Wispr Flow is the first voice dictation platform people use more than their keyboards — because it understands you perfectly on the first try. It's context-aware, personalized, and works anywhere you can type, on desktop or phone.

Dictation is just our first act. We're building the interaction layer for your computer — a system that's capable, understands you, and earns your trust. It will start by writing for you, then move to taking actions, and ultimately anticipate your needs before you ask.

We're a team of AI researchers, designers, growth experts, and engineers rethinking human-computer interaction from the ground up. We value high-agency teammates who communicate openly, obsess over users, and sweat the details. We thrive on spirited debate, truth-seeking, and real-world impact.

This year, we've grown our revenue 50% month-over-month and with our latest $30M Series A, this is just the beginning.

About The Role
We're looking for a
Senior Analytics Engineer
to help us design, build, and scale the analytical foundation that powers insights across product, growth, and operations. You'll work at the intersection of data engineering and analytics - transforming raw product, GTM, and finance data into clean, reliable models that enable everyone at the company to make better, faster, and data-informed decisions.

This role is highly cross-functional: you'll partner with Product, Marketing, Growth, and Finance teams to ensure our analytics stack is robust, scalable, and purpose-built for experimentation, reporting, and machine learning.
